关节镜下小粗隆孤立性撕脱骨折的螺钉固定技术

Arthroscopic Screw Fixation Technique for an Isolated Avulsion Fracture of the Lesser Tuberosity.

Abstract

Isolated avulsion fractures of the lesser tuberosity of the humerus are rare and can be difficult to diagnose. This study presents a fully arthroscopic technique for anatomic reduction and screw fixation of these injuries. The described method allows precise visualization, fragment control, and secure fixation using standard arthroscopic portals and equipment. It also allows simultaneous assessment and treatment of concomitant intra-articular pathologies. This technique offers a minimally invasive alternative to traditional open surgery, providing advantages such as reduced postoperative pain, minimal scarring, and faster rehabilitation.

摘要

肱骨小结节孤立性撕脱骨折较为罕见,且可能难以诊断。本研究介绍了一种用于这些损伤的解剖复位和螺钉固定的全关节镜技术。所描述的方法使用标准关节镜入路和设备,可实现精确可视化、碎骨块控制及牢固固定。它还能同时评估和治疗合并的关节内病变。该技术为传统开放手术提供了一种微创替代方案,具有术后疼痛减轻、瘢痕最小化及康复更快等优点。
